Я собираюсь перестроить свой сервер, и мне интересно, установить ли мне GCC 32 или 64 бит. Я разрабатываю на Python и использую некоторые библиотеки, которые выиграют от 64-битной установки GCC, но я не уверен, что у меня возникнут проблемы с другими программами / библиотеками. Что ты думаешь?
Мое практическое правило:
Перейдите на 64-битную версию. Это не больно. Все существующие на сегодняшний день процессоры поддерживают его (кроме Intel Atom). 32-битные однажды исчезнут, 64-битным еще предстоит долгая жизнь.
Если это серверное приложение, перейдите на 64-разрядную версию и сохраните некоторую ретро-совместимость.
Мое практическое правило:
Если на вашем компьютере меньше 4 гигабайт оперативной памяти, ни одному из ваших процессов не требуется больше 2 гигабайт памяти, и вам не нужны никакие новые инструкции набора команд x86_64, используйте 32-битную (x86) систему.
В противном случае выберите 64-битный (x86_64).